Position Summary

Manage regional payroll operations for various APAC countries to ensure timely and accurate processing of end-to-end payroll cycles. Countries covered include but are not limited to Philippines, Australia, New Zealand, Singapore, Malaysia, Vietnam, Indonesia, Thailand and Pakistan.

This position interacts with various levels of personnel both inside and outside the company. That interaction requires good communication skills and judgement, tact and diplomacy with internal and external customers in troubleshooting problems and communicating status. Effectiveness in this role requires a thorough working knowledge of relevant payroll processes and systems, policies and procedures. Accuracy is required in performing all functions of this position. Initiative and organisation skills are valuable to ensure the timely completion of a large volume of work, within short timelines.

The position reports to the Payroll Manager

Essential Functions:

  • Manages day to day payroll operations for multiple APAC countries.

  • Checks, validates and ensures completeness and timeliness of submissions for approval and approvals of payroll deliverables

  • Develops, manages, and monitors payroll SLAs/KPIs.

  • Drives the team to work in meeting and exceeding customer expectations.

  • Coaches, trains, and develops the team.

  • Prepares, analyzes, conducts, and presents to key stakeholders as required.

  • Provides guidance to team members in analysing complex payroll calculations and executing solutions that meets statutory regulations.

  • Resolves escalations by providing root cause analysis and corrective action for complex or non-routine situations

  • Liaises with vendors and work on solutions when needed.

  • Responsible for ensuring that standard operating models including standard payroll report formats, SOP, checklist, payroll calendars, record keeping etc. are up to date.

  • Assists in audit operations and implement audit recommendations

  • Develops controls and procedures to ensure compliance with policy

  • Interprets, analyses and applies statutory rules, compliance regulations and corporate policy to ensure pay is accurate.

  • Keeps abreast with payroll regulatory changes, review and analyze tax and legal regulations, identify issues/implications affecting company and employees and update related payroll process

  • Provides back-up support to team members as required.

  • Performs other duties as assigned.
